Dr. Johnny Smelz is a physiatrist practicing in Little Rock, AR. Dr. Smelz is a medical doctor specializing in physical medicine and rehabilitation. As a physiatrist, Dr. Smelz focuses on a patients ability to function, and can treat multiple conditions that affect the brain, nerves, spine, bones, muscles, joints, ligaments and tendons. Dr. Smelz can diagnose and treat pain that is a result of injury, disease or a disabling condition. Physiatrists often lead a team of physical therapists, occupational therapists and physicians in a patients treatment or prevention plan.
